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
780877998 558411658 6589599 7314
371101068 576689179 31504753
371101068 576689179 31504753
093 7358 41 029496
All about undefined
Interested in learning more?
371101068 576689179 31504753
093 7358 41 029496
See more
75121 2485 582
647 866 2455952 6016823270
See more
76882 251
872799 2562714740 08121949648
See more